Enhancing Engagement Through Sensory Experiences
One of the most compelling reasons to adopt learning with nature is its ability to engage
all the senses. Unlike traditional classroom settings, nature invites learners to touch, see,
hear, smell, and sometimes even taste their way through lessons. This multisensory
approach strengthens memory retention and helps learners build meaningful associations
with the material.
For example, a simple activity like collecting leaves can teach classification and biology
while also encouraging tactile exploration and artistic expression. Listening to bird songs
can sharpen auditory skills and introduce concepts in animal behavior and ecology.

1. Choose Accessible Natural Spaces
You don’t need to trek into a remote wilderness to benefit from nature-based learning.
Parks, community gardens, schoolyards, and even urban green spaces offer ample
opportunities for exploration. The key is to select locations that are safe, convenient, and
rich in natural features like trees, plants, insects, or water elements.
Regular visits to the same spot can deepen observational skills, as learners notice
changes across seasons and weather conditions.
2. Set Open-Ended Questions and Challenges
Encouraging inquiry is at the heart of inspiring curiosity. Instead of delivering facts, pose
questions that prompt learners to investigate and hypothesize. For instance:
What kinds of insects can we find under this log?
How does the texture of different leaves vary?
Why do some plants grow better in shady spots?
These questions invite exploration and critical thinking, allowing learners to take
ownership of their discoveries.
3. Incorporate Storytelling and Reflection
Stories help contextualize experiences and make learning emotionally resonant. Share
myths, legends, or scientific tales related to the natural elements encountered during
outdoor activities. Afterwards, encourage learners to reflect through journaling, drawing,
or group discussion, which reinforces understanding and personal connection.

Science and Ecology
Nature is a living laboratory for studying biology, environmental science, and earth
science. Activities like pond dipping to observe aquatic life, soil testing, or tracking animal
footprints provide hands-on learning that textbooks can’t replicate.
Mathematics
Outdoor environments offer natural examples to explore mathematical concepts such as
measurement, patterns, and geometry. Measuring tree circumferences, counting petals,
or identifying symmetry in leaves make math tangible and relevant.
Language Arts
Encourage descriptive writing, poetry, and storytelling inspired by nature walks.
Observing and articulating the sights, sounds, and feelings experienced outdoors enriches
vocabulary and expressive skills.
Art and Creativity
Nature’s colors, shapes, and textures are perfect for creative projects. Collecting natural
materials for collages, sketching landscapes, or photographing wildlife stimulates
imagination and artistic appreciation.

The Role of Curiosity in Nature-Based Learning
Curiosity is a fundamental driver of learning, and nature provides a uniquely stimulating
environment to inspire it. When learners are immersed in a forest, garden, or any green
space, they encounter dynamic systems and phenomena that prompt questions and
exploration. This organic curiosity leads to inquiry-based learning, which is widely
recognized for developing critical thinking and self-directed learning skills.
Studies show that students engaged in outdoor education demonstrate higher levels of
motivation and enthusiasm. For example, research published in the Journal of
Environmental Psychology found that even short periods spent in natural environments
can restore attention and reduce mental fatigue, thereby improving focus during
subsequent academic tasks.

Case Studies: Successful Applications of Learning with Nature
Examining real-world examples provides valuable insights into how learning with nature is
operationalized in diverse contexts.
Forest Schools in Scandinavia
Originating in Scandinavia, forest schools immerse children in woodland environments for
daily learning. The approach focuses on child-led exploration, risk assessment, and social
interaction. Research indicates that participants develop stronger executive function skills
and improved resilience compared to traditional classroom peers.
Urban Green Spaces in the United States
In densely populated urban areas, initiatives have transformed vacant lots into community
gardens and outdoor classrooms. These projects provide opportunities for experiential
learning about food systems, biodiversity, and community engagement. Students report
increased environmental awareness and a stronger connection to their neighborhoods.
